Aerial survey of beaver in watersheds of eastern and northern slopes of Riding Mountain, October 1957 / Donald R. Flook.: CW66-974/1957E-PDF
"The purpose of the survey was to learn where beaver might be stocked-to advantage in the watersheds of the north and east slopes of Riding Mountain so as to help stabilize the run-off"--Introduction, page 1.
